Demographics

Blue Jay has a population of 1,797 with a median age of 36.9. Here is the racial and ethnic breakdown of the population:

Income & Economy

The median household income in Blue Jay is $117,859, which is 46.2% above the national median of $80,610. The per capita income is $43,883. The poverty rate is 8.2%.

Education

In Blue Jay, 91.9% of residents age 25+ have a high school diploma or higher, and 26.1% hold a bachelor's degree or higher (13.6% with a graduate or professional degree).

Housing

The median home value in Blue Jay is $242,500, below the national median of $303,400. The median monthly rent is $1,113. The homeownership rate is 80.5%.
